Bug#661309: RFS: task-spooler/0.7.3-1 [ITP] (fix policy violation)

2012-06-09 Thread Alexander Inyukhin
On Sun, May 27, 2012 at 11:12:04AM -0300, David Bremner wrote:
 David Bremner brem...@debian.org writes:
 
  I'll have a look at this.
 
 I sent a separate mail about some warnings from cppcheck and
 compilation. These might not be blockers, but the following is, your
 package currently violates policy 10.1
 
   Two different packages must not install programs with different
   functionality but with the same filenames.
 
 ( http://www.debian.org/doc/debian-policy/ch-files.html#s-binaries )
 
 In particular your package ships /usr/bin/ts, which is also present in
 moreutils.
 
 Note that conflicts are not appropriate to resolve this problem; it is
 perfectly plausible for people to want both moreutils and task-spooler
 installed.
 
 Since your package is the new one, the obvious thing is for you to
 rename your version. I leave that to you and Joey Hess (the moreutils
 maintainer) to sort out.

The conflict is resolved by renaming ts to tsp.

Re: RFS: task-spooler

2009-08-04 Thread Alexander Inyukhin
On Mon, Aug 03, 2009 at 08:48:52PM -0300, David Bremner wrote:
 1) I expect whoever does sponsor it will ask you to compress
 debian/changelog a bit. Typically there should be 1 changelog entry
 per debian upload. Sorry I didn't mention this in my mail to BTS.

I've just re-uploaded the package.

http://mentors.debian.net/debian/pool/main/t/task-spooler/task-spooler_0.6.4-3.dsc

 2) Is there any security risk in the control socket(s) for ts being
 world readable? Or is that just controlled by users umask?

Read and write permissions are required to connect unix socket on Linux.

Socket permissions are controlled by umask, but if security
matters, a more sophisticated way of managing sockets should be used.
Since task-spooler is intented for use in single user environment,
I do not think this is a serious issue.

Re: RFS: task-spooler

2009-08-04 Thread Alexander Inyukhin
On Tue, Aug 04, 2009 at 09:52:23AM -0500, Boyd Stephen Smith Jr. wrote:
 In 20090804100620.ga8...@shurick.s2s.msu.ru, Alexander Inyukhin wrote:
 Socket permissions are controlled by umask, but if security
 matters, a more sophisticated way of managing sockets should be used.
 Since task-spooler is intented for use in single user environment,
 I do not think this is a serious issue.
 
 Unfortunately, Debian is not limited to use as a single-user environment so 
 you may need to revisit the security implications.  At the very least, you 
 may want to warn the administrator that it is not suitable for multi-user 
 environments.
 
 Any reason task-spooler can't secure it's sockets the same way ssh-agent 
 and/or gpg-agent secure theirs?

Actually, it can. It is just not the default behavior.
User may override socket location via environment variables TMPDIR or TS_SOCKET.
As with gpg-agent, this requires additional setup.

Creating socket with predefined name in user's home directory seems to be
a better choice. Is there any policy rules about socket naming?
